Перейти к основному содержанию
GET
/
compute
/
swap-base-out
Расчёт котировки swap (фиксированный выход)
curl --request GET \
  --url https://transaction-v1.raydium.io/compute/swap-base-out
{
  "id": "550e8400-e29b-41d4-a716-446655440000",
  "success": true,
  "version": "V1",
  "data": {
    "inputAmount": "<string>",
    "outputAmount": "<string>",
    "priceImpact": "<string>",
    "routes": [
      {}
    ]
  }
}

Documentation Index

Fetch the complete documentation index at: https://docs.raydium.io/llms.txt

Use this file to discover all available pages before exploring further.

Параметры запроса

inputMint
string
обязательно

Адрес минта входного токена.

outputMint
string
обязательно

Адрес минта выходного токена.

amount
string
обязательно

Желаемое выходное количество в наименьшей единице (ламортах).

slippageBps
string
обязательно

Максимальная допустимая проскальзывание в basis points (0–10000).

txVersion
enum<string>
обязательно

Версия трансакции Solana.

Доступные опции:
V0,
LEGACY

Ответ

Котировка swap рассчитана успешно.

id
string

Уникальный идентификатор запроса (UUID).

Пример:

"550e8400-e29b-41d4-a716-446655440000"

success
boolean

Успешен ли расчёт.

Пример:

true

version
string

Версия API ответа.

Пример:

"V1"

data
object

Результат расчёта swap.